Story summary
- Matt Chamberlain, CEO of the London Metal Exchange, notes that supply disruptions have led to a short-term copper price squeeze amid renewed U.S.-China tensions.
- Chinese smelters are increasing exports to capitalize on high London prices, even as domestic demand slows.
- Analysts expect copper demand to rise 24% over the next decade, driven by technology and industrial growth.
- Disruptions in the copper supply chain could cause scarcity if not addressed.
